About five years ago, administrators said, they realized they needed to upgrade disaster-response training. “We obviously have a limited experience with explosions in an urban area,” said Dr. Alasdair Conn, Mass. General’s chief of emergency services. “The Israelis, unfortunately, have this several times a year, and we asked their disaster-response teams to come and help us upgrade our disaster response,” Conn said. “And I’m very pleased that we went through that orientation and additional training.” http://bostonglobe.com/lifestyle/health-wellness/2013/04/15/boston-hospitals-treat-injured-with-wounds-more-often-seen-war-zones/MczjJJkkdLvjzqR9MK407N/story.html |
